Why Indoor Plant Pots MatterIt's easy to assume that any pot will do, but the reality is more nuanced. A poorly chosen plant pot can lead to root rot, stunted growth, or an unattractive interior. On the other hand, the right pot not only complements your décor but also supports plant health. Key Reasons to Choose the Right Pot:
